随着物联网时代的到来,海量数据不但需要快速储存,同时也要有高速分析和查询能力,以满足业务的扩张和发展对“超级快”的要求。Redis作为当下最为流行的内存数据库,其“超级快”的响应能力可以支撑后台系统的高并发处理业务,并弥补了RDBMS(关系型数据库)的不足。
Redis的持久化及特性,使它具备灵活的数据结构,以及海量数据的快速导入导出能力,可以满足大多数数据库场景。但是,当海量数据导入Redis耗时较长时,常常会影响到业务处理性能及正常运行。

针对此类问题,我们可以通过一些方法来避免。我们如能采用 RedisCluster、Redis Sentinel或Redis Replication的一致性技术,来分布式部署 Redis,提升 Redis 的并发能力及负载均衡能力,也能提高 Redis 的导入导出效率;采用多种声明式批量插入及更新策略,来有效提高数据导入及查询性能;再次,通过优化 Redis 的配置参数,提高数据库性能及执行速度;采用 Redis 的 Lua 脚本化批量操作 api 功能,减少大量单条命令操作,有效提升数据批量操作效率。
例如,在 Java 中,不仅要使用普通 JDBC 来连接 Redis,而且要使用 Jedis 或 Redisson 等 Redis 客户端,同时用到哈希表的 Mset() 方法,进行批量操作,比如批量导入/更新 Redis 的数据:
//构造”KV”数据,形成 Map 集合
Map kv = new HashMap();
kv.put(“key1″,”value1”);
kv.put(“key2″,”value2”);
//执行批量导入/更新
jedis.mset(kv);
运用以上技术可以有效提升数据导入及处理效率,极大程度地改善 Redis 的海量数据的导入性能。
香港服务器首选树叶云,2H2G首月10元开通。树叶云(shuyeidc.com)提供简单好用,价格厚道的香港/美国云 服务器 和独立服务器。IDC+ISP+ICP资质。ARIN和APNIC会员。成熟技术团队15年行业经验。
声纹学产品有哪些?作用还有特点,要详细!
伊拉克战争的重要影响之一就是检验新技术的实用水平,其中从声音识别人就特别引人注目,其中最关键的是如何做到万无一失。 伊拉克战争正在如火如荼地进行着,双方在媒体宣传上也是战况激烈。 在美国第一轮“斩首”行动之后,伊拉克总统萨达姆马上发表电视讲话,鼓舞士气,同时证明自己的存在。 然而,美国联邦调查局的情报人员则称,发表电视讲话的并非萨达姆其人。 此时,德国科学家分别从图像理解与分析、声纹识别两个方面证明发表讲话的就是萨达姆本人。 随后萨达姆又发表了与战事内容相关的讲话,证明了他确实还“健在”。 这样一则不惹人注意的新闻消息背后,却有着一个不同寻常然而又为各国情报部门所大力研发的军事科技:声纹识别。 声纹识别源于语音识别声纹识别类似于指纹识别。 指纹经过数字化处理以后,以人的手指表面皮肤纹理图像的形式存储于计算机。 假如我们从犯罪现场提取罪犯的指纹,然后和计算机的存储资料对比,或者与嫌犯的指纹对比,就可以确定罪犯的身份或者犯罪证据。 同样,声音也携带着每个说话人的个体信息。 所谓声纹是指能惟一识别某人或某物的声音特征。 例如,在上边的例子中,无论萨达姆在何时、何地发表不同内容的讲话,他的声纹始终是不变的,因此可以此断定一种声音是否是其本人发出的。 当然,是事先录好还是现场直播,则另当别论。 然而,只是理解声纹还是不够的,人们还需要准确地知道声纹的具体参数,才能准确地从很多人中辨认出说话者是谁,或者是什么东西发出的声音。 如何提取声纹,怎样提取才能保证识别的准确性,有了声纹如何比对,怎样处理和分离海量声频数据中的其他不相关信息,都是这项技术实现的难点。 其实声纹识别(speaker recognition)是一种广义的语音识别。 在司法、公安、通信、机要等领域具有重要的应用价值。 近年来,这一技术发展迅速,已经出现了一些实用系统。 目前声纹识别一般利用包含话者语音波形中特有的个体信息(声纹),自动识别话者身份。 从学术研究的角度上讲,它属于统计模式识别和人工智能应用领域。 声纹识别分为话者辨认和确认。 辨认是从有限的话者集合中分辨不同的人,系统性能随着话者集增大而降低;确认是系统只给出接受或拒绝两种选择。 从电视讲话判定说话人,如萨达姆是否是其人,就属于确认的过程,它的难度往往更大一些。 从处理的语言内容上看,声纹识别又分成限定文本和非限定文本两种。 如果说无论美国总统布什说什么,系统都能认出是他,而不是别人,这就是非限定文本识别,这种识别更难一些。 目前最流行的用于识别的短时谱特征是LPC(linear Predictive Coefficients)及MFCC (Mel Frequency Cepstral Coefficients)。 当然技术的发展有两面性,伴随语音技术的发展,伪装语音或伪装声纹技术也有相应的进步,所以才需要人们去认识和把握一项科技的应用。 声纹识别的过程及参数提取一般的声纹识别过程如图1所示。 图1 声纹识别的一般过程我们需要一份想要识别的人的原始语音信号作为对照。 而这段语音信号必须经过声纹提取,形成一个模板,才能与下一次的输入做比较,从而判断是不是要找的人。 那么构成声纹的参数有哪些呢?从已有的研究可以归纳为短时频谱、基音周期、短时能量、短时过零率、倒谱、LPC参数和MFCC参数。 语音信号是一种典型的时变信号。 如果把观察时间缩短到十毫秒或几十毫秒,则语言信号是近似平稳的,这是由于人的发音器官不可能是毫无规律地快速变化。 例如,具有重大意义的LPC参数,就可以非常好地表达人的发音过程,即所谓的声管模型。 这些参数的计算也往往基于语音信号的短时信息(帧)。 如果把它们配合使用,则可以大大提高识别效率和准确性。 目前主要的难度在于能不能找到、发现可惟一标识某人或某物的这组参数,而且这组参数还是在开集条件下不限定文本的。
微信小程序可以给中小企业及商家带来哪些帮助?
微信小程序可以帮助载体平台打造生态闭环。 以微信小程序为例,小程序在微信上能够实现消息通知、线下扫码、公众号关联等七大功能。 其中,通过公众号关联,用户可以实现公众号与小程序之间的相互跳转。 由于微信小程序还在发展初期,很多热衷于尝试新事物的用户对其有着较高的兴趣,如果中小企业能够使开发的小程序满足某些功能需求的同时,又具备较高的趣味性,很容易吸引用户的关注。 对于传统企业来说,可以充分利用小程序从线上引流到线下的方式,实现客源扩充的目的,微信是基于移动社交的软件,因而,微信小程序也具有强烈的社交功能,旅游行业、服装行业、家具行业、婚庆行业、教育行业等这些有线下门店的行业,都可以借助小程序实现企业崛起。
金山毒霸,百度杀毒,360安全卫士,电脑管家应该用哪个比较好
展开全部建议您安装腾讯电脑管家杀毒软件,比较不错的!!免费专业安全软件,2合1杀毒版集“专业病毒查杀!!智能软件管理、系统安全防护”于一身,开创了“杀毒 + 管理”的创新模式!!占电脑内存小,消耗电脑资源少。 杀毒效果比较好,防护性能好,基本没有误报误杀呀。 依托小红伞(antivir)国际顶级杀毒引擎、腾讯云引擎,鹰眼引擎等四核专业引擎查杀能力,病毒识别率提高30%,深度根除顽固病毒!全方位保障用户上网安全。 管家云引擎、管家自研引擎、金山云引擎、Avira引擎,以及管家系统修复引擎,完美解决杀毒修复问题!!希望可以帮到您了 您的采纳就是我回答的动力!
发表评论